摘要
For successfully achieving the European Flood Risk Management Directive agriculture also needs to act according to principles of integrated integrated flood risk management. There are several options for acting concerning a highly professional practice in the field of the cultivation of land and the soil protection. Agricultural methods that use a plough, do not operate in a supportive way for the infiltration. Therefore it is important to realize procedures that are preventive and gentle for the soil. Furthermore there needs to be conservative soil cultivation and direct seeding. Locally, it is possible to increase water retention through additional procedures, such as dams.
